perl函数原型
摘要:
大多数perl函数定义都是没有指定参数个数及类型的,所有传入的参数都保存在@_数组中,如果想指定参数个数及类型,那么就要使用函数原型了。看下面的例子use strict ;sub test($$){ my($var1,$var2) =@_ ; print$var1,"\n" ; print$var2,"\n" ;}test(1,2) ;1 ;上面的test函数就使用了函数原型,在函数定义时元括弧内加入参数定义,上面$$表示两个标量参数。这样就保证test值接受两个参数,且都是标量,所以下面的调用都可以test(1,2) ;test(1,"a&q 阅读全文
posted @ 2011-08-05 22:05 perlman 阅读(743) 评论(0) 推荐(0) 编辑